Chinese scientists have tested a non-nuclear hydrogen bomb as part of the People's Liberation Army's move towards cleaner energy solutions. Developed by the China State Shipbuilding Corporation's 705 Research Institute, the bomb uses magnesium hydride to release hydrogen gas, creating a sustained fireball exceeding 1,000 degrees Celsius for over two seconds. This innovation allows for precise control over blast intensity and uniform destruction across vast areas. China's military is utilizing renewable energies like hydrogen power to enhance its capabilities. The bomb, with its unique features, can effectively target dispersed enemy forces or high-value points with surgical precision. With the inauguration of a mass production facility for magnesium hydride, China is ramping up production to 150 tonnes annually.
